In addition, we will address often asked concerns to supply a clearer understanding of these necessary kitchen appliances.What is a Built Under Single Oven?A built-under single oven is developed to be set up under a counter top, supplying a smooth look in the kitchen while saving valuable flooring space. These ovens are frequently preferred for their compact design, making them ideal for smaller sized cooking areas or those looking for a minimalist visual. Built-under ovens can provide the same functionality as traditional wall ovens but in a more effective and space-saving way.
Features to ConsiderWhen looking for a built-under single oven, a number of features ought to be thought about:
- Size and Dimensions: Ensure the oven will fit in the designated space.
- Capacity: Look for the interior volume suitable for cooking needs.
- Energy Efficiency: Check for energy rankings to minimize expenses.
- Kind of Oven: Decide in between standard, fan-assisted, or convection ovens depending on cooking preferences.
- Controls: Evaluate user-friendliness; think about digital screens vs. standard knobs.
- Cleaning up Features: Self-cleaning or easy-clean interiors can conserve time and effort.
- Security Features: Look for features like automatic shut-off and cool-touch doors.
- Design and Finish: Aesthetics ought to complement the kitchen design.

With its turbo heating function, this entry-level oven heats up quickly, which is perfect for hectic cooking. Its compact size makes it appropriate for smaller sized kitchens without jeopardizing performance.Benefits of Built Under Single Ovens
- Area Saving: Fits neatly beneath counters, releasing up floor area.
- Adaptability: Offers various cooking functions to match a variety of culinary needs.
- Modern Aesthetic: Enhances kitchen style with a smooth, integrated look.
- Availability: Easier to access at waist height than wall-mounted ovens, minimizing stress.
Setup ConsiderationsWhile built-under single ovens are an excellent space-saving choice, appropriate setup is important. Follow these tips:
- Measure the Space: Double-check the measurements of your kitchen’s cabinetry before purchasing.
- Check Ventilation: Ensure there is sufficient ventilation to prevent overheating.
- Electrical Requirements: Verify that your kitchen can support the oven’s electrical requirements.
- Level Installation: Ensure the oven is level for optimum cooking performance.
